Associate Managing Consultant, Advisors & Consulting Services, MarketingOverview• MasterCard Advisors is comprised of three synergistic business units with distinct P&Ls: Consulting Services, Information Services, and Managed Services. These business units are supported by Advanced Analytics, Advisors Promotion & Marketing, Information Technologies & Advisors Technology Integration, Data Acquisition & Business Development, Human Resources & Development, Finance, Operations, Law and a Project Management Office.
• Consulting Services is charged with combining professional problem-solving skills with deep payments expertise to address the challenges and opportunities of its clients, enhance MasterCard's strategic and tactical performance and establish MasterCard's global thought-leadership preeminence.
• Information Services is responsible for the direct monetization of MasterCard’s differentiated data asset.
• Managed Services is charged with providing superior executional services and turn-key solutions by leveraging MasterCard’s unique differentiated data asset and exceptional modeling and analytical capabilities on behalf of large and small clients.

Role Description and Major Responsibilities
Responsible for delivering top quality work as the Associate Managing Consultant in the global delivery team including consulting services, test & learn and data & analytics.
• Function as a project manager for delivery projects
• Rigorously and logically identify issues covering client problems in the projects managed
• Generate key hypotheses and independently structures work at the project level
• Develop effective working relationships with mid- to senior-level client management
• Synthesize analyses into clear, sound recommendations
• Identify creative and useful additional analyses required and suggest new paradigms for recommendations
• Independently assess client agenda, internal culture and change readiness.
• Create effective, impactful and quality assured storylines and slides at the project level
• Participates in recruiting, training, and developing team members
